The Investigation Service exposed one person for breach of the procedure related to the movement of goods across the customs border

As a result of operative-searching and investigative activities, Investigation Service of the Ministry of Finance of Georgia together with employees of the Customs Department of the Revenue Service exposed one person on the fact of breach of the procedure related to the movement of goods across the customs border of Georgia.


According to the investigation, it has been determined, that person mentioned above illegally brought especially large quantities of undeclared jewelry products to Georgia, including 280 grams of gold and 244 grams of silver alloy, through the Munich-Kutaisi flight.


As a result of investigative activities, jewelry has been seized with total customs value of GEL 26 563.


Investigation is ongoing on the case under article 214 of the Criminal Code of Georgia, which envisages imprisonment from 5 to 7 years.
